研究概览

简要总结

The purpose of this study was to investigate whether transcutaneous electrical nerve stimulation (TENS) could reduce pain during cannulation of vein.

详细描述

One hundred patients were allocated randomly to two groups: In the active TENS group TENS was delivered via two electrodes on the venous cannulation site (radial side of the wrist of dominant forearm) 20 min prior to venous cannulation and control group received placebo (no current) TENS. Venous cannulation with a 22 gage cannula was performed. During venous cannulation the pain intensity (0 = no pain, 10 = worst pain imaginable) was measured. Any side effects during study periods were recorded

入选标准

  • outpatients who underwent plastic surgery

排除标准

  • concomitant sedative or analgesic medication,
  • neurological disease.
  • all patients with potentially dangerous internal diseases (American Society of Anesthesiologists' physical status > 3).
